以下为对“iOS版TPWallet最新版”的全方位综合分析梳理,聚焦你指定的五个方面:防病毒、合约快照、专业剖析展望、高效能技术管理、链间通信与PAX。由于不同版本在细节上可能随时间更新,文中以“通用的合规验证思路 + 可操作检查项”为主,便于你在最新版应用上复核。
一、防病毒(安全与恶意风险的综合判断)
1)安装来源与完整性核验
- 只从官方渠道获取:App Store或明确标注的官方发布通道。
- 关注是否存在“非正常权限申请”:例如联系人、短信、设备管理等与加密钱包功能高度不相关的权限。
- 发现异常时的处理:不要继续导入私钥/助记词;先撤销敏感权限并进行卸载后重装,或改用官方渠道获取。
2)运行时安全与钓鱼识别
- 钱包类应用的主要攻击面通常来自“伪装交易/钓鱼签名/假链接”。
- 建议重点观察:
a. DApp 浏览器/内置发现模块中,交易详情页是否清晰展示关键字段(合约地址、转账数量、网络、滑点等)。
b. 在发起签名时,是否能明确提示“签名内容摘要/将授权的权限范围”。
c. 是否存在“跳转外部链接”却遮蔽真实目标域名的情况。
3)网络与证书/代理风险
- 避免在“可疑Wi-Fi/代理环境”进行关键操作。
- 若应用允许使用自定义节点或代理,建议先用默认配置验证稳定性与可信度。
4)建议的安全操作习惯
- 小额测试:新启用链或新合约前,先用少量资产验证转账与到账。
- 设备隔离:日常登录与签名可用专用设备/低风险环境。
- 备份与恢复:助记词/私钥绝不在屏幕录制、云端明文备份、第三方剪贴板工具中出现。
二、合约快照(合约状态、升级与可追溯性)
“合约快照”在钱包语境里,通常指:对合约相关信息的记录、对交易/权限的可验证回溯,或对关键合约在某时间点的状态摘要呈现。由于具体实现可能因链与协议不同而不同,建议用以下维度理解并自查:
1)快照包含哪些“可验证要素”
- 合约地址与链ID:是否能精确对应到同一网络。
- 关键事件/权限变更:例如授权(Approval)、代理合约路由、升级(Proxy/Implementation)相关信息。
- 交易/签名记录:用户在钱包内发起的签名与交易是否可在链上复查。
2)升级合约与代理模式的风险
- 常见情况:代理合约(Proxy)指向可升级实现合约。
- 若是可升级合约,快照要能反映“某时点对应的实现合约/权限范围”。
- 钱包应在详情页提供可核对的信息,避免用户只看到“统一的合约名”却无法追溯真实实现。
3)你可以做的验证动作
- 对可疑授权:在链上查看Approval授权额度、spender地址、token合约。
- 对关键交换/路由:核对交易参数是否与你在应用内看到的一致。
- 对“快照记录”:确认其来源是链上可追溯数据,而非仅应用本地的显示缓存。
三、专业剖析展望(对未来版本的能力评估框架)
从“专业剖析”的角度,最新版钱包应在以下方向持续增强:
1)可审计性与透明度提升
- 把“用户看不懂的链上细节”转化为“可核对的关键字段”。
- 对合约调用路径、路由聚合器、授权变更提供更结构化解释。
2)合约风险提示更智能
- 引入更完善的风险分类:新合约/高风险权限/可升级合约/黑名单与冻结机制等。
- 给出“建议操作”:例如减少无限授权、使用更安全的交易路径、提示滑点与价格影响。
3)跨链资产一致性校验
- 重点在:到账金额与币种单位(decimals)、手续费与中转路径的透明展示。
- 对异常情况的回退/申诉信息更清晰。
4)隐私与安全的平衡
- 本地密钥管理与最小权限原则。
- 可选的隐私模式:例如减少可被动采集的日志,或对外部数据请求更透明。
四、高效能技术管理(性能、可用性与资源治理)
钱包不仅要安全,也要“快且稳”。高效能管理可从以下维度观察:
1)交易与路由的性能
- 刷新速度:资产列表、价格、手续费估算是否延迟明显。
- 路由聚合:链上查询与路由计算应缓存策略合理,避免频繁触发阻塞。
2)本地存储与缓存策略

- 资产、代币元数据、交易历史索引等应采取合理缓存。
- 同时需确保:链上最新状态发生变化时,能及时刷新(避免“展示旧数据”造成误操作)。
3)错误处理与重试机制
- 在网络波动或RPC异常时,钱包应有清晰的失败提示与可恢复逻辑。
- 对“交易已提交但未确认”的状态展示更友好,避免用户重复发送。
4)电量与稳定性
- iOS下应用通常受系统后台策略影响:前台签名与后台查询需平衡。
- 对长耗时任务(例如同步代币列表、拉取历史)应采用分页/增量更新。
五、链间通信(跨链的可验证体验)
链间通信决定了用户体验与资金安全的底层一致性。建议从以下角度理解:
1)跨链的核心链路
- 路由层:选择哪条桥/中转协议/聚合器。
- 状态层:跨链消息的确认、最终性与重试。
- 资产层:代币的锁定/铸造/销毁或等价映射。
2)钱包应提供的关键透明信息
- 跨链费用明细:手续费、桥费用、兑换/路由成本。
- 时间与最终性说明:预计完成时间、确认阶段。
- 风险提示:如中转合约权限、桥风险、可能的失败退款机制(若协议提供)。
3)安全建议
- 跨链前先确认:目标链、接收地址、代币类型(主网/侧链/包装资产)。
- 对高额跨链先做小额验证。
- 若出现异常状态,避免重复提交;优先查看链上/桥协议的状态页或交易回执。
六、PAX(如何在钱包中识别与使用)
PAX通常指 Paxos 发行的稳定币资产(常见为 PAX/USDP 体系相关资产,具体代币符号与网络部署需以链上为准)。你在钱包里看到“PAX”时,应关注:
1)代币合约与网络匹配
- 不同链可能存在不同合约地址与不同decimals。
- 钱包应确保:展示的PAX为你当前网络下的正确代币。
2)价格与赎回机制认知

- 稳定币的“锚定与赎回机制”通常依赖发行方与其规则。
- 钱包显示“价格偏差”时,应理解其可能来源于链上流动性与兑换深度,而非必然等于锚失效。
3)交易与兑换路径
- 使用PAX进行兑换或跨链时,要核对:
a. 交换对与路由(PAX/USDT、PAX/USDC等)。
b. 滑点与最小接收(Minimum Received)。
c. 是否发生包装/解包(例如在某些链上对应包装资产)。
4)合规与安全操作
- 对PAX授权保持克制:能用“仅需额度”就避免无限授权。
- 确保交易详情页信息完整:合约地址、数量、网络与手续费。
结论(综合评价)
- 安全层面:重点不在“宣传式防病毒”,而在“可核对的交易细节 + 权限可视 + 风险提示 + 链上复查能力”。
- 合约快照与可追溯性:应以链上数据为依据,尤其对可升级代理合约与授权变更要做到可复核。
- 链间通信:透明费用、清晰状态与避免重复提交,是提升安全与体验的关键。
- 高效能技术管理:稳定的RPC与合理缓存可减少延迟与误操作风险。
- PAX:正确识别网络上的PAX合约、核对decimals与兑换/跨链路由参数,是避免资产差异的核心。
如果你愿意,我可以再按“你使用的具体iOS版TPWallet版本号、主要链(如ETH/BSC/Polygon/Arbitrum等)、以及你关注的某个PAX网络部署”做进一步定制化核对清单(包括你在App内应查看的具体页面项)。
评论
Kai
整体框架很专业,尤其是把“链上可复核”当成核心标准这一点我很认同。
小雨点123
PAX那段提醒我注意decimals和合约地址差异,确实容易踩坑。
Mina_Liu
跨链费用明细和最终性提示如果做得好,能显著降低重复提交风险。
NeoRex
合约快照如果能把代理实现合约也一起呈现,会比只显示合约名更靠谱。
张诚C
防病毒我更关注权限申请和钓鱼签名的识别,你这条清单很实用。